Getting an individual score of more than 150 runs is still not a common occurrence in ODIs. Out of the total of 4,070 ODIs played, there have been only 117 instances when a batsman has crossed that 150-run mark.

Rohit Sharma has achieved this feat seven times, which is the most by any player. He was able to add to his tally courtesy his two recent knocks of more than 150 runs against West Indies in the recently concluded bi-lateral ODI series.

Normally, when a batsman scores such a huge pile of runs, his team members sit comfortably in the dressing room. However, there have been occasions when even these masterful innings could not secure victory for the team.

Out of the 117 individual scores of 150+, only 15 have resulted in defeat. Here, we revisit the five greatest of such innings.

#5 Rohit Sharma (IND), 150 (133) vs South Africa at Kanpur

Helped by a brisk century from AB de Williers and a quickfire cameo by Farhaan Behardien, South Africa managed 303/5 in their first innings.

India began their chase on the right track and at one stage were 191-1 in the 34th over. Rohit Sharma played a blistering knock of 150 that included 13 boundaries and 6 sixes.

Ajinkya Rahane built a partnership of 149 runs with Rohit for second wicket. However, Rahane consumed too many deliveries for his innings of 60 runs, and a rare failure by Virat Kohli left Rohit with not much support from the other end.

At his dismissal, India needed 35 runs off 23 deliveries, and they eventually lost the match by 5 runs. Rohit scored more than half of India’s innings but unfortunately could not take his team to the victory mark.
